Capitol Beat News Service: Paper ballots focus of latest election reform push

Anne Herring, policy analyst for Common Cause Georgia, raised concerns about the latter provision.

โ€œThe governor and lieutenant governor get to vote on whether their own races will be audited,โ€ Herring told LaHoodโ€™s committee. โ€œThatโ€™s a little concerning to me in terms of public confidence in elections.โ€

U.S. Census Bureau Releases New Format of Data for a More Participatory Redistricting Process

Today, the U.S. Census Bureau will release population data from the 2020 Census in an easy-to-use format for Americans who want to advocate for fair maps in this yearโ€™s redistricting cycle. The new format of the data will be made available to all 50 states, the District of Columbia, and Puerto Rico and will be key to increasing participation in the ongoing redistricting efforts.
